Transaction 21e88dae6a1c396ae89d4a719dc0092896690005f2380acab53370d6402fd5f2
1 Input
1 Output
-
21e88dae6a1c396ae89d4a719dc0092896690005f2380acab53370d6402fd5f2:0
- value
- 644448
- script pubkey
- OP_0 OP_PUSHBYTES_20 45297e630c721e15146c15b71ddb62b4b058ac00
- address
- bc1qg55huccvwg0p29rvzkm3mkmzkjc93tqq4u5e8w